#dacec2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dacec2 is composed of 85.5% red, 80.8%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.5% magenta, 11%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 24.5% and a lightness of 80.8%. #dacec2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b59d85.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#dacec2 color description : Light grayish orange.
#dacec2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dacec2 has RGB values of R:218, G:206,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.11,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14339778.
